How to fill out basic programmable logic controllers:
01
Familiarize yourself with the manufacturer's guidelines: Before starting, it is important to read and understand the guidelines provided by the specific manufacturer of the programmable logic controller (PLC) you will be working with. This will ensure that you have the right knowledge and tools to fill out the PLC accurately.
02
Identify the inputs and outputs: Take note of the various inputs and outputs that need to be connected to the PLC. This includes sensors, switches, actuators, and other devices that the PLC will interact with. Make sure to understand the purpose and function of each input and output.
03
Connect the inputs and outputs: Using the appropriate wiring and connectors, connect the inputs and outputs to their corresponding terminals on the PLC. Ensure that the connections are secure and properly labeled for easy identification.
04
Configure the PLC program: Depending on the specific application, you will need to configure the PLC program accordingly. This involves setting up the necessary logic, instructions, and sequence of operations that the PLC will execute. Use programming software provided by the manufacturer to create and edit the program.
05
Test the functionality: Once the PLC program is configured, perform thorough testing to verify its functionality. Activate the inputs and observe the outputs to ensure that the PLC is responding as intended. Make any necessary adjustments or modifications to the program if required.
06
Document the setup: It is essential to document the entire setup, including the wiring connections and program configuration. This documentation will serve as a reference for future troubleshooting, maintenance, and modifications.
Who needs basic programmable logic controllers:
01
Manufacturing industry: PLCs are widely used in the manufacturing industry for automating processes and controlling machinery. Industries such as automotive, food and beverage, pharmaceuticals, and many others utilize PLCs to improve efficiency, productivity, and reliability.
02
Building automation: PLCs are also commonly used in building automation systems to control lighting, HVAC (heating, ventilation, and air conditioning), security systems, and other building functions. They provide centralized control and monitoring capabilities, making buildings more energy-efficient and enhancing occupant comfort.
03
Industrial automation: In various industrial settings, PLCs are essential for automating repetitive tasks, controlling production lines, monitoring equipment performance, and ensuring efficient operations. Industries such as oil and gas, mining, power generation, and water treatment heavily rely on PLC technology.
Overall, basic programmable logic controllers are needed by industries and sectors that require automation, control, and monitoring of processes, equipment, and systems. The versatility and reliability of PLCs make them a vital component in numerous applications across different fields.
